diff options
Diffstat (limited to 'plat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java')
-rw-r--r-- | plat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java b/plat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java index 897d169e1845..821d9dbd6bc3 100644 --- a/plat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java +++ b/platform/lang-impl/src/com/intellij/execution/ui/layout/impl/RunnerContentUi.java @@ -1271,6 +1271,17 @@ public class RunnerContentUi implements ContentUI, Disposable, CellTransform.Fac return null; } + @Nullable + public void restoreContent(final String key) { + for (AnAction action : myMinimizedViewActions.getChildren(null)) { + Content content = ((RestoreViewAction)action).getContent(); + if (key.equals(content.getUserData(ViewImpl.ID))) { + action.actionPerformed(null); + return; + } + } + } + public void setToDisposeRemovedContent(final boolean toDispose) { myToDisposeRemovedContent = toDispose; } |